Can: Poured a dark brown beer with a nice above average head with good retention. Aroma is a mix of malt and mild sweetness. Taste was quite nice with some smooth malt and a subtle sweet finish with a good banana taste at the ends. Alcohol is well hidden which is always nice. The thin body and the subtle watery aftertaste was bit of a letdown but overall, I think this was a nice offering from a macro brewers – a bit underrated I feel…

Nice golden color with white head and some lace. Skunked grassy, ashy aroma. It has some hop bitterness in the flavor as well as hints of malt, carbonated mouthfeel. This could be a nice beer without an odd plastic side flavor, which seems to be common in NA beers.
